cod vba afisare foi de calcul dupa o selectie
cod vba afisare foi de calcul dupa o selectie
Buna seara caut un cod vba care sa reafiseze foile de calcul dupa o selectie (lista) cu numele foilor de calcul .
va mutumesc
va mutumesc
Nu aveţi permisiunea de a vizualiza fişierele ataşate acestui mesaj.
-
- Mesaje: 437
- Membru din: Mar Dec 11, 2018 8:54 pm
Re: cod vba afisare foi de calcul dupa o selectie
Salut,
E neclara formularea. Fii mai explicit.
Ce inseamna "sa reafiseze foile.....", sunt foi ascunse?
Exemplifica.
E neclara formularea. Fii mai explicit.
Ce inseamna "sa reafiseze foile.....", sunt foi ascunse?
Exemplifica.
藍
"I fear the day that technology will surpass our human interaction. The world will have a generation of idiots."
Albert Einstein
"I fear the day that technology will surpass our human interaction. The world will have a generation of idiots."
Albert Einstein
Re: cod vba afisare foi de calcul dupa o selectie
foile din lista sunt ascunse(hide) si caut un macro sa unhide foile cu denumirea din lista
Re: cod vba afisare foi de calcul dupa o selectie
Buna ziua
Testati codul plasat in Module2 din fisierul atasat:
Pentru testare: deschideti fisierul atasat, activati macro/continutul, selectati celulele care contin numele de foi dorite si rulati macro de la buton
IP
Testati codul plasat in Module2 din fisierul atasat:
Cod: Selectaţi tot
Sub UnhideSheets()
'IPP - 09.10.2023
Application.ScreenUpdating = False
Application.Calculation = xlCalculationManual
On Error Resume Next
For Each c In Selection
If c.Value <> "" Then
If Sheets(c.Value).Visible = False Then Sheets(c.Value).Visible = True
End If
Next c
On Error GoTo 0
Application.Calculation = xlCalculationAutomatic
Application.ScreenUpdating = True
End Sub
IP
Nu aveţi permisiunea de a vizualiza fişierele ataşate acestui mesaj.